1. History of Pocket Watches
Throughout the centuries, pocket watches have served as a symbol of class and sophistication. They first emerged in the 16th century, but it was not until the 17th century that they became more accessible to the general population. Pocket watches quickly gained popularity due to their portability and precision.
During the 18th and 19th centuries, pocket watches underwent significant advancements in mechanical engineering. The advent of interchangeable parts made them more reliable and easier to repair. The precise craftsmanship required to create these timepieces elevated them to the status of exquisite works of art.
2. Evolution of Design
Over time, pocket watch designs evolved to reflect the changing trends and tastes of society. Early pocket watches featured simple appearances with metal cases and porcelain dials. These gave way to elaborate engravings, jeweled movements, and intricate enamel or guilloche patterns.
By the 20th century, the introduction of wristwatches led to a decline in the popularity of pocket watches. However, many vintage and antique pocket watches continue to captivate collectors and enthusiasts who appreciate their craftsmanship and historical value.
3. Types of Pocket Watches
There is a wide variety of pocket watches available, each with its unique features and characteristics. Some notable types include open-faced pocket watches, hunter-case pocket watches, and railroad pocket watches. These watches vary in terms of their case design, movement type, and additional complications such as chronographs or calendars.
4. Identifying Pocket Watches
Identifying the authenticity and origin of a pocket watch is crucial for collectors. By examining hallmarks, serial numbers, and manufacturer engravings, experts can determine the age, material, and heritage of the timepiece. Furthermore, experts use different criteria when evaluating the condition and value of a pocket watch, including the movement’s quality and any unique features it may possess.
